@daydreaming.about.data: Why do we need silent letters in English? There are several reasons why we have and need ‘silent letters’ in English! The main ‘job’ of the English spelling system is to communicate meaning! One of the main reasons unpronounced letters occur in words is to help us make etymological connections (meaning connections) to other words in that word family. These letters are referred to as ⭐️etymological markers⭐️ …basically a letter or group of letters that do not represent a phoneme (sound) in a word, but remain part of the spelling to help us make meaningful connections to related words. 🔗 The word ‘people’ comes from the same word family as population and populate, both of which contain a clearly pronounced ‘o’. 🔗 We can connect the word ‘muscle’ to muscular…where the C is clearly pronounced. 🔗 The ‘n’ in damn not only differentiates it from the homophone dam, but also signals its connection with the word damnation (notice the ‘n’ is clearly pronounced). 🔗 The ‘i’ in friend is there to show the etymological connection to Friday, which derives directly from the Anglo Saxon patron goddess of friendship. #teachers #LearnOnTikTok #earlyliteracy #spelling #english #earlyliteracy #funfact #morphology #tipsforteachers
